Toronto police are asking for help finding a 46-year-old last seen on Wednesday in the Bloor Street West and Ossington Avenue area. Officers say they are concerned for the person’s safety.

Semed, 46, was last seen on Wednesday, September 9 in the area of Bloor Street West and Ossington Avenue, according to 14 Division.
Police describe Semed as 5’10” with a thin build, a shaved head and a scruffy beard, last seen wearing a grey and black checkered jacket, grey pants and white Converse shoes, and carrying a black backpack.
Anyone with information is asked to call police at 416-808-1400.
Toronto police note that a person can be reported missing at any time — there is no waiting period.
